how is information about magnetic fields recorded in rocks?

Answers

Information about magnetic fields in rocks is recorded through the alignment of magnetic minerals, such as magnetite, with the Earth's magnetic field at the time the rock was formed.

As magma or lava cools and solidifies, the magnetic minerals become "frozen" in place and retain the orientation of the Earth's magnetic field. By studying the magnetic orientation of rocks, scientists can determine the direction and strength of the magnetic field at the time the rock was formed, as well as track the movement of the Earth's magnetic poles over time.

This technique is called paleomagnetism and has been used to study the Earth's magnetic field history over millions of years.

of the following, which color represents the lowest surface temperature for a star? yellow, orange, red, white, and blue

Answers

The color represents the lowest surface temperature for a star is option (3) red

The surface temperature of a star is one of the key factors that determine its color. The color of a star also depends on its composition, size, and distance from us, but temperature is the most important factor.

Stars emit light across a wide range of wavelengths, from radio waves to gamma rays. The peak of this emission is determined by the star's surface temperature, following a pattern called Planck's law. Hotter stars emit more blue and violet light, while cooler stars emit more red and infrared light.

The sequence of colors that represent the different surface temperatures of stars is commonly referred to as the "spectral sequence" or "color sequence". This sequence starts with blue stars (the hottest), followed by white, yellow, orange, and red stars (the coolest).

Therefore, the correct option is (3) red

What is voltage divider formula?

Answers

Voltage divider formula is a circuit formula used to calculate the output voltage of a circuit that is divided between two resistors. It is [tex]Vout = Vinx(R2/(R1+R2)[/tex]

A voltage divider circuit consists of two resistors in series with an input voltage applied across them, and the output voltage is taken from the point between the two resistors. The voltage divider formula:

[tex]Vout = Vin x (R2 / (R1 + R2))[/tex]

Vout: circuit's output voltage of the circuit

Vin: circuit's input voltage

R1: circuit's resistance value of first resistor

R2: circuit's resistance value of the second resistor

The voltage divider formula shows that the output voltage of the circuit is proportional to the ratio of the two resistors. If the value of R2 is increased, the output voltage will increase, and if the value of R1 is increased, the output voltage will decrease.

why does warm, moist air start to uplift in the initial stages of thunderstorm development?'

Answers

Warm, moist air starts to uplift in the initial stages of thunderstorm development because of a combination of different lift mechanisms.

One of these is convective lift, which occurs when warmer air rises due to its buoyancy. This is because warm air is less dense than cooler air, and so it is more easily displaced by the cooler air. Another lift mechanism is orographic lift, which is the result of air being forced to rise as it moves over a mountain or hill. Finally, frontal lift occurs when a cold front moves into an area of warm, moist air, forcing it to rise. All of these lift mechanisms can combine to cause warm, moist air to be lifted and form a thunderstorm.

What is law of universal gravitation meaning?

Answers

The law of universal gravitation states that every particle in the universe attracts every other particle with a force that is directly proportional to the product of their masses and inversely proportional to the square of the distance between them.

The law states that every object in the universe attracts every other object with a force that is directly proportional to the product of their masses and inversely proportional to the square of the distance between them.

This means that the larger the masses of the objects and the closer they are to each other, the stronger the force of attraction will be. The law of universal gravitation helps explain many phenomena in the universe, including the orbits of planets and moons round their parent bodies, as well as the motion of stars and galaxies.

how to convert pascals to atm

Answers

To convert pascals (Pa) to atmospheres (atm), you can use the following conversion factor: 1 atm = 101325 Pa

Pascal (symbol: Pa) is the unit of pressure in the International System of Units (SI). It is defined as the force of one newton acting over an area of one square meter.

In other words, the pascal is a measure of the pressure or stress on a surface that results from a force being applied uniformly over that surface. For example, if you apply a force of 100 newtons over an area of 1 square meter, the pressure would be 100 pascals (since 1 Pa = 1 N/m^2).

The pascal can also be expressed in terms of other units, such as the bar (1 bar = 100,000 Pa) or the atmosphere (1 atm = 101,325 Pa). The pascal is commonly used in many fields of science and engineering, including fluid mechanics, aerodynamics, and material science. It is also used to express other physical quantities such as stress, strain, and modulus of elasticity.

This means that one atmosphere is equal to 101325 pascals. To convert pascals to atmospheres, you can divide the pressure value in pascals by 101325.

For example, to convert 500000 Pa to atm:

500000 Pa / 101325 = 4.93 atm (rounded to two decimal places)

Therefore, 500000 Pa is approximately equal to 4.93 atm.
